In late 2023, the City of Rancho Palos Verdes partnered with Tripepi Smith on a strategic communications initiative aimed at keeping residents informed about the accelerating movement, impacts and mitigation efforts in the ancient Portuguese Bend Landslide Complex. Land movement has long been a challenge for Rancho Palos Verdes, due to its location within an active landslide zone.

The City of Indian Wells partnered with Tripepi Smith to produce its 2025 State of the City and Hospitality Awards event. Together with the Greater Coachella Valley Chamber of Commerce, the City has transformed the annual address into a dynamic presentation featuring a live mayoral speech, pre-recorded video messages from each council member and live award presentations.
